Everyone who owns a personal computer has the ability to produce professional documents with relatively little effort. Worryingly, evidence is growing that the technology is being used for nefarious purposes. Computer-aided counterfeiting is on the increase.
The latest example is the faked letter purporting to be from Harrogate Borough Council which shows that desktop forgers can turn their hands to almost anything. It is up to us all to be on our guard.
Meanwhile, organisations that distribute employee identification badges on which the public rely must look at making them more difficult to copy.
